آموزش ادغام TeamCity در گردش کار موجود

Integrating TeamCity into Existing Workflows

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یویی برای نمایش وجود ندارد.
توضیحات دوره: در این دوره یاد خواهید گرفت که چگونه TeamCity را به انواع ابزارهای توسعه از جمله سیستم های اعلان ، مدیریت کنترل منبع ، ردیاب ها و IDE متصل کنید. اجرای خودکار ساخت ها ارزش قابل توجهی را به همراه دارد ، اما ابزارهای دیگری نیز در توسعه نرم افزار وجود دارد که مدیریت آن بدون اتصال به آنها دشوار است. در این دوره ، ادغام TeamCity در گردشهای موجود ، شما توانایی اتصال TeamCity را با انواع ابزارهای توسعه و چرخه زندگی کسب خواهید کرد. ابتدا یاد خواهید گرفت که چگونه اعلان های ساخت را به سه روش مختلف ، از جمله با Slack ، تنظیم کنید. در مرحله بعدی ، خواهید فهمید که چگونه TeamCity را با سیستم های ردیاب مسئله متصل کنید تا ساختها را به طور خودکار با مشکلاتی که برطرف می کنند مرتبط کنید. علاوه بر این ، شما یاد خواهید گرفت که چگونه فراتر از کشیدن از SCM برای انجام ساخت ، با مدیریت کنترل منبع ادغام شوید. نحوه استفاده از TeamCity API را تقریباً برای هر مورد استفاده سفارشی مشاهده خواهید کرد. سرانجام ، "Builds شخصی" را با چندین IDE ایجاد خواهید کرد تا محیط های آزمایشی را برای توسعه دهندگان فراهم کنید. پس از پایان این دوره ، مهارت و دانش TeamCity Integrations مورد نیاز برای اتصال TeamCity با بقیه ابزارهای گردش کار و افزایش چشمگیر بهره وری را خواهید داشت.

سرفصل ها و درس ها

بررسی اجمالی دوره Course Overview

  • بررسی اجمالی دوره Course Overview

ایجاد اعلان های ساخت Creating Build Notifications

  • بررسی اجمالی اعلان ها Build Notifications Overview

  • اعلان کننده مرورگر Browser Notifier

  • راه اندازی اعلانگر مرورگر Setting up the Browser Notifier

  • هشدار دهنده ایمیل Email Notifier

  • راه اندازی Notifier Email Setting up the Email Notifier

  • Slack Notifier Slack Notifier

  • راه اندازی Slack Notifier Setting up the Slack Notifier

  • ساخت خلاصه اعلان ها Build Notifications Summary

ادغام با سیستم ردیاب شماره Integrating with an Issue Tracker System

  • بررسی اجمالی یکپارچه سازی ردیاب Issue Tracker Integration Overview

  • مراحل پیکربندی Configuration Steps

  • تنظیم ادغام با جیرا Setting up the Integration with Jira

  • همبستگی بین ساختها و مسائل Correlation between Builds and Issues

  • نقشه برداری TeamCity به مشکلات جیرا می پردازد Mapping TeamCity Builds to Jira Issues

  • خلاصه ادغام ردیاب شماره Issue Tracker Integration Summary

ادغام با مدیریت کنترل منبع Integrating with Source Control Management

  • مروری بر مدیریت کنترل منبع Source Control Management Integration Overview

  • درخواست ساخت ویژگی ساخت Pull Requests Build Feature

  • پیکربندی و استفاده از ویژگی Pull Required Build Configuring and Using the Pull Requests Build Feature

  • تعهد ناشر وضعیت Commit Status Publisher

  • پیکربندی و استفاده از ناشر تعهد وضعیت Configuring and Using the Commit Status Publisher

  • خلاصه ادغام مدیریت کنترل منبع Source Control Management Integration Summary

با استفاده از TeamCity API Using the TeamCity API

  • بررسی اجمالی TeamCity API TeamCity API Overview

  • مستندات API API Documentation

  • درک احراز هویت TeamCity API Understanding TeamCity API Authentication

  • احراز هویت با API TeamCity Authenticating with the TeamCity API

  • درک چگونگی راه اندازی یک Build با API Understanding How to Trigger a Build with the API

  • راه اندازی یک Build با API Triggering a Build with the API

  • درک نحوه استخراج جزئیات ساخت با API Understanding How to Extract Build Details with the API

  • استخراج جزئیات ساخت با API Extracting Build Details with the API

  • خلاصه API TeamCity TeamCity API Summary

ادغام با IDE برای ایجاد ساخت های شخصی Integrating with an IDE to Create Personal Builds

  • نمای کلی ساختمانهای شخصی Personal Builds Overview

  • درک ساختهای شخصی با Visual Studio Understanding Personal Builds with Visual Studio

  • ایجاد بناهای شخصی از Visual Studio Creating Personal Builds from Visual Studio

  • درک ساختهای شخصی با IntelliJ Understanding Personal Builds with IntelliJ

  • ایجاد سازه های شخصی از IntelliJ Creating Personal Builds from IntelliJ

  • خلاصه بناهای شخصی Personal Builds Summary

نمایش نظرات

Pluralsight (پلورال سایت)

Pluralsight یکی از پرطرفدارترین پلتفرم‌های آموزش آنلاین است که به میلیون‌ها کاربر در سراسر جهان کمک می‌کند تا مهارت‌های خود را توسعه دهند و به روز رسانی کنند. این پلتفرم دوره‌های آموزشی در زمینه‌های فناوری اطلاعات، توسعه نرم‌افزار، طراحی وب، مدیریت پروژه، و موضوعات مختلف دیگر را ارائه می‌دهد.

یکی از ویژگی‌های برجسته Pluralsight، محتوای بروز و با کیفیت آموزشی آن است. این پلتفرم با همکاری با توسعه‌دهندگان و کارشناسان معتبر، دوره‌هایی را ارائه می‌دهد که با توجه به تغییرات روزافزون در صنعت فناوری، کاربران را در جریان آخرین مفاهیم و تکنولوژی‌ها نگه می‌دارد. این امر به کاربران این اطمینان را می‌دهد که دوره‌هایی که در Pluralsight می‌پذیرند، با جدیدترین دانش‌ها و تجارب به روز شده‌اند.

آموزش ادغام TeamCity در گردش کار موجود
جزییات دوره
2h 22m
36
Pluralsight (پلورال سایت) Pluralsight (پلورال سایت)
(آخرین آپدیت)
-
از 5
دارد
دارد
دارد
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Alexander Page Alexander Page

الکس با تمرکز بر راه حل های آزمایش مداوم به عنوان مهندس DevOps در Broadcom کار می کند. او از یک برنامه نویس کاملاً پشته است و با چندین شرکت در زمینه نوشتن نرم افزارهای مهم ماموریت به زبانهای مختلف همکاری کرده است. علاوه بر این ، او تمرکز خود را بر روی اتوماسیون آزمایش قرار داده است - به طور خاص با چارچوب های اتوماسیون تست UI لبه خونریزی و روش های آزمون نوظهور (به عنوان مثال آزمایش مبتنی بر مدل). وقتی او با همسرش در خارج از کوهپیمایی ، کوهنوردی یا اسکی نباشد ، معمولاً برای سرگرمی در حال بازی یا کدنویسی است.